    A Brief History of Sash Windows

    Sash windows have their roots in 17th-century England, where they were initially introduced as a more useful and elegant option to standard casement windows. The name "sash" refers to the horizontal or vertical panels that move up and down within a frame, usually counterbalanced by weights or springs. Over the centuries, sash windows have evolved to accommodate altering architectural styles and technological developments, however their basic style has stayed mostly the same.

    Benefits of Sash Windows

    So, why are sash windows still a popular choice in Crawley and beyond? Here are simply a couple of benefits:

    • Aesthetics: Sash windows are renowned for their sophisticated, balanced design, which can include a touch of sophistication to any space.
    • Energy Efficiency: When correctly maintained, sash windows can be remarkably energy-efficient, thanks to their ability to seal tightly and prevent heat loss.
    • Ventilation: Sash windows allow for outstanding airflow, making them ideal for spaces that need excellent ventilation, such as kitchens and bathrooms.
    • Low Maintenance: With routine maintenance, sash windows can last for decades with minimal repair work or replacement required.
    • Security: Sash windows are normally more secure than other types of windows, as the sashes are hard to remove from the exterior.

    Repair and maintenance

    To keep your sash windows in excellent working order, regular maintenance is important. Here are some tips:

    • Clean the windows routinely: Use a soft fabric and moderate cleaning agent to clean the glass and frames.
    • Lube the hinges and pulleys: Apply a percentage of oil or silicone-based lube to the moving parts.
    • Check the sashes for damage: Inspect the sashes for signs of wear or damage, and repair work or replace as needed.
    • Replace the cables or chains: If the cables or chains are frayed or broken, replace them with new ones.

    Choosing the Right Sash Windows for Your Crawley Home

    When picking sash windows for your Crawley home, consider the following factors:

    • Style and design: Choose a style that complements your home's architectural design and period functions.
    • Product: Decide whether you prefer standard lumber or modern-day uPVC or aluminum frames.
    • Energy effectiveness: Look for windows with a high energy score and features such as double glazing and draught-proofing.
    • Spending plan: Set a budget and adhere to it-- sash windows can range from inexpensive to very costly, depending on the products and features you choose.
